    A manager is a manager, he/she needs to be a leader of men/women and does not necessarily need to have done that type of work at the highest level or professionally. In football terms, players would run through brick walls for Brian Clough because he motivated and inspired them and although Clough did play professionally, his career was cut short due to injury and so did not have a particularly outstanding footballing career. Some people naturally have Leadership qualities - this cannot always be taught, its a little like someone who is an ‘Alpha-male’. People will follow a good leader in all walks of life just ask any battle-hardened solder.
